Doom of Dead – base game

Theme-wise, not really—so get ready for yet another trip to Ancient Egypt in a 5-reel, 10 payline slot. You’ll be treated to temples, columns, snakes, and gods, all presented with the polished production values Play’n GO is known for. The expanding wild’s, especially, look strikingly detailed. Set inside an Egyptian tomb chamber, it’s instantly familiar territory if you’ve played other titles from this category. The artwork is sharp, and the animations are impressively crafted.

With the standard Play’n GO stake range of 10 p/c to $/€100 per spin, players join the energetic Cat Wilde on the expedition. Anyone who enjoys high volatility should be happy—its 10 out of 10 rating puts it right at the extreme end. The Default RTP is a solid 96.29%, though it may be reduced depending on the casino. As a reminder, it’s possible to find Book of Dead sitting in the low-to-mid 90s, so it’s worth checking the paytable before you start.

Backing up the dusty setting is a set of Egyptian-flavoured symbols. The 10-A low pays aren’t exactly ancient artefacts, but the styling helps them blend in well enough. The premium symbols include scarabs, Anubis, a Sphinx, and Cat Wilde herself. ‘Book of’ slots are known for decent symbol payouts, and Doom of Dead follows suit. As an example, five premium symbols pay anywhere from 7.5x for the scarabs up to 100x for the determined Cat.

One slightly uncommon detail is that the game includes a separate wild symbol as well as a scatter. Whenever the standard 1×1 wild lands, it expands into a full reel wild featuring an Egyptian god. Wilds replace any other paying symbols and pay 100 times the stake for a five-of-a-kind line.

Cat Wilde and the Doom of Dead: Features

Alongside the expanding wilds, tomb raiders can chase the iconic ‘Book of’ free spins round. This famous bonus triggers when 3 compass scatters land on reels 1, 3, and 5 simultaneously. You receive 10 free spins, and before they begin, one regular symbol—chosen from either the low or high end of the paytable—is randomly picked to become the special expanding symbol.

Whenever the special symbol can form a winning combination, it expands to cover full reels. These expanded special symbols pay from anywhere on the reels—they don’t need to land next to each other. So if they appear on reels 1, 3, and 5, for instance, they’ll still pay as though they landed on the first three reels. The ideal outcome is landing five wilds, or five expanded Cat Wilde symbols, to hit the game’s maximum single spin payout.

Scatters can also appear during free spins, meaning the feature can theoretically retrigger endlessly—although Play ‘n GO has implemented a win cap in case that occurs.

Her solo debut carries respectable potential, capped at 5,000 times the stake—a result that occurred once every 1 billion spins during Play’n GO’s simulation. One important point is that because symbol values are somewhat limited, you can’t land 5,000x in a single spin the way you can in some other ‘Book of’ slots. As usual, it’s the bonus round that creates the real opportunity for big moments. Here, it’s not only the expanding special symbols doing the work, but also full reel wilds increasing the number of ways to connect wins.
